Brillat-Savarin is a luxurious French triple-cream cheese made from cow's milk, renowned for its rich, buttery flavor and velvety texture. At Fromagerie Chez Virginie, this cheese is received fresh and meticulously aged in their cellars for about a month to develop its full character.
The aging process allows the cheese to form a delicate white to ivory-colored bloomy rind, while the interior remains smooth and homogeneous, offering subtle aromas of mushrooms and hazelnuts, complemented by a gentle cream and butter scent. Brillat-Savarin pairs wonderfully with a fresh organic Rosé from Provence, such as "Pétale de Rose" by Régine Sumeire, or a white Sancerre like "Cuvée Spéciale Les Shasseignes" by Philippe Raimbault.
Chez Virginie is a renowned Parisian cheese shop located in the heart of Montmartre, with a tradition dating back to 1946. Founded by the Boularouah family, this fromagerie is known for its dedication to quality and authenticity. Virginie Boularouah, a master cheesemonger and heir to the family craft, personally selects and ages the cheeses in her own cellars, ensuring optimal flavor and maturity.
